THE
TRANSFER PROCESS
Our skilled craftsmen begin with your fine art print.
A protective laminate is applied by hand to the surface of the artwork,
then adhered permanently. This
layer safeguards your artwork from the ravaging effects of the environment;
dirt, dust, even the harmful UV rays of sunlight.
Employing a specialized process perfected in our US workshop, we bond
your image to 100% cotton, primed artist’s canvas, replicating the look and
feel of the original painting. This
method can also be applied to a photographic image, also rendering the
appearance of an oil painting.
HAND STRETCHING
Your canvas transfer can be hand-mounted to
corner-joined, artist’s stretcher bars. The
stretched transfer is ready to be framed in your shop, awaiting your personal
expertise. Or, to minimize shipping
costs, we can return your transfer to you simply rolled in a tube.

HAND APPLIED BRUSHSTROKES
We retain a number of skilled artisans who can enhance the
look of your canvas transfer by hand applying brushstrokes with artist’s
acrylic medium. This custom process
ensures that your completed canvas transfer closely matches the original
painting and is itself a one-of-a-kind work of art.
CUSTOMIZED TREATMENTS
Your canvas transfer comes with a choice of surface
finishes (gloss and satin matte) and canvas textures (fine, medium and coarse).
Pricing is determined by the united inch (width + height).
Non-stretched transfers have standard margins of 1 ½”, allowing for
stretching in your shop. Standard
stretching fees apply to whole inches; custom stretcher sizes are available at
additional cost. All work is
